An iceboat with a mass of 30 kg moves on a horizontal lake with a coefficient of friction of 0.5. If the wind exerts a constant force, Fon the iceboat that starts from rest and covers a distance of 25.0 m in 1 minute. What is the velocity of the iceboat at a distance of 25.0 m?​

1 Answer

3 votes

Answer:

S = V0 t + 1/2 a t^2

25 = 1/2 a (60)^2 since iceboat starts from rest V0 = 0

a = 50 / 3600 m/s^2 = .0139 m/s^2

V = a t = .0139 m/s^2 * 60 s = .833 m/s
